Tourist Visa Australia 2026: Quick Overview

Before starting your application, it’s important to understand what the Subclass 600 visa is designed for.

The Visitor Visa Subclass 600 is a temporary Australian visa that can allow you to visit Australia for:

  • Tourism and holidays
  • Visiting family or friends
  • Certain short-term business activities
  • Conferences and business events
  • Other permitted visitor activities

The visa is issued by the Australian Department of Home Affairs, and applications are generally submitted online through ImmiAccount. Unlike some other Australian visitor visa options, Subclass 600 is available to applicants from a very wide range of nationalities.

The visa is electronically connected to your passport. You generally won’t receive a physical visa sticker or stamp, so keeping your Visa Grant Notice available when traveling is a smart idea.

Tourist Visa Australia Streams Explained

One of the biggest mistakes applicants make is choosing the wrong stream. The Subclass 600 framework includes different streams designed for different circumstances.

1. Tourist Stream — Offshore

The Offshore Tourist Stream is generally the most relevant option for applicants who are outside Australia and want to visit for tourism or to see family and friends.

According to the supplied 2026 guide, applicants may receive a stay period of up to 3, 6, or 12 months, depending on their circumstances and assessment. The application charge listed in the source is AUD 250 from 1 July 2026.

A longer visa period isn’t guaranteed. A strong travel history, convincing financial evidence, and clear ties to your home country can support a stronger overall application.

2. Tourist Stream — Onshore

The Onshore Tourist Stream is designed for eligible applicants already in Australia who want to remain as visitors.

Before applying, carefully check the conditions attached to your current visa. In particular, a No Further Stay condition can prevent you from applying for another visitor visa from inside Australia in many circumstances.

The source lists the application charge for this stream as AUD 630 from 1 July 2026.

3. Business Visitor Stream

The Business Visitor Stream is intended for short-term business activities such as:

  • Attending conferences
  • Participating in trade fairs
  • Making business enquiries
  • Negotiating contracts
  • Taking part in certain government-related visits

You can’t use this stream to work for an Australian business or receive payment for services performed in Australia. If your main purpose is a holiday and you’re simply attending one business meeting, the Tourist Stream may be more appropriate.

4. Sponsored Family Stream

The Sponsored Family Stream may apply when an eligible family member in Australia sponsors a visitor.

The sponsor generally needs to be an Australian citizen, permanent resident, or eligible New Zealand citizen. A security bond may be requested in certain cases, particularly where the Department considers there is an increased risk that the visitor may not comply with the visa conditions.

5. Approved Destination Status Stream

The source also identifies the Approved Destination Status (ADS) stream for eligible Chinese passport holders traveling as part of an approved organized tour arrangement. Individual applicants from other nationalities don’t use this stream.

Who Is Eligible for a Tourist Visa Australia?

Although individual streams have different requirements, applicants generally need to satisfy several core requirements.

You should be able to demonstrate that you:

  1. Are a genuine temporary visitor.
  2. Have enough money to support yourself during the trip.
  3. Meet applicable health requirements.
  4. Meet character requirements.
  5. Will comply with your visa conditions.
  6. Have appropriate arrangements for healthcare during your stay.

There is no English language test, points test, or specific age limit for the standard tourist visa framework described in the source.

The most important issue, however, is often not simply whether you have enough money. It’s whether the entire application tells a logical and credible story.

The Genuine Visitor Requirement Explained

The Genuine Visitor assessment is one of the most important parts of a modern tourist visa Australia application.

The Department of Home Affairs replaced the previous Genuine Temporary Entrant framework with the Genuine Visitor assessment for visitor visa applicants in March 2024. The central question is whether the applicant genuinely intends to visit Australia temporarily and leave as required.

Your Home-Country Ties Matter

A case officer can consider your personal and professional circumstances in your home country.

These may include:

  • Employment
  • Business ownership
  • Property
  • Family responsibilities
  • Dependants
  • Other established commitments

For example, an applicant with stable employment, approved leave, property, a spouse, and children remaining at home may be able to present stronger evidence of reasons to return.

Your Financial History Matters

Having money in your bank account isn’t enough by itself.

The source emphasizes the importance of genuine and consistent financial evidence. A sudden large deposit immediately before applying can create questions about where the money came from and whether it genuinely belongs to the applicant. Six months of consistent financial activity can be much more persuasive.

Your Immigration History Matters

Previous visa applications, refusals, overstays, cancellations, and immigration issues should be disclosed honestly.

Trying to hide an earlier refusal can create a much bigger problem than the refusal itself. Accuracy and transparency are essential.

Your Travel Purpose Must Make Sense

A statement such as “I want to visit Australia” is too vague to explain the circumstances of a real trip.

Instead, your application should clearly establish:

  • Why you’re traveling
  • How long you’ll stay
  • Where you’ll stay
  • Who you’ll visit, if applicable
  • What activities you’ll undertake
  • Why you’ll return home

The Genuine Visitor assessment is holistic, meaning the overall evidence is considered rather than just one document.

Tourist Visa Australia Documents Checklist

Strong documentation can help make your application clearer and reduce unnecessary delays.

Identity Documents

Prepare documents such as:

  • Valid passport
  • National identity document, where applicable
  • Birth certificate
  • Marriage certificate, if relevant

The supplied guide recommends having a passport with sufficient validity beyond the planned return date.

Financial Documents

Financial evidence may include:

  • Six months of bank statements
  • Salary slips
  • Employment income evidence
  • Tax records
  • Business financial documents
  • Property or asset evidence
  • Sponsor’s financial documents, where applicable

Your documents should tell a consistent financial story. For example, your stated salary, bank credits, employment information, and planned travel expenses should reasonably fit together.

Genuine Visitor Documents

Evidence supporting your intention to return can include:

  • Employment confirmation letter
  • Approved leave or NOC
  • Salary information
  • Property ownership or lease documents
  • Marriage documents
  • Children’s birth certificates
  • Family Registration Certificate for Pakistani applicants
  • Business ownership documents

An employer letter should ideally confirm your position, salary, employment status, approved leave, and expected return-to-work date.

Travel Documents

You may also provide:

  • Flight itinerary
  • Accommodation booking
  • Proposed travel itinerary
  • Invitation letter for a family visit
  • Host’s passport and Australian status evidence
  • Business invitation or conference information, where relevant

Health and Other Documents

Depending on your circumstances, additional documents may include:

  • Health examination results
  • Private health insurance
  • Police clearance certificate
  • Previous Australian visa grant notices

Always follow the specific document requests shown in your application and ImmiAccount.

Tourist Visa Australia Processing Time 2026

Processing times aren’t guaranteed and can change depending on application volume, completeness, security checks, health requirements, and individual circumstances.

The supplied July 2026 figures state:

Stream75% of Applications90% of Applications
Tourist — Offshore20–29 days33 days
Tourist — OnshoreTypically 4–8 weeksLonger where complex
Business Visitor3–15 days20 days
Sponsored Family27 daysUp to 8 weeks

For an offshore Tourist Stream application, the source recommends applying at least 4 to 6 weeks before the planned travel date rather than waiting until the last minute.

What Can You Do on a Tourist Visa?

A tourist visa Australia allows certain visitor activities, but it comes with important restrictions.

Activities Generally Permitted

Depending on your visa conditions, you can generally:

  • Travel around Australia
  • Enjoy tourism and sightseeing
  • Visit family and friends
  • Attend certain short business meetings and events
  • Study for up to three months
  • Travel in and out of Australia where multiple entries are granted
  • Participate in limited unpaid volunteer activities where permitted

Activities Not Permitted

You cannot use the visa to:

  • Work in Australia
  • Receive payment for Australian work
  • Provide services to an Australian business
  • Undertake paid employment
  • Study beyond the permitted period

The source specifically warns that working while holding a tourist visa can result in serious immigration consequences, including visa cancellation and potential problems with future applications.

Why Tourist Visas Are Refused

A refusal can be frustrating, but many common problems can be identified before submission.

Weak Genuine Visitor Evidence

If your application doesn’t clearly demonstrate why you’ll return home, the case officer may question your temporary intentions.

Unexplained Bank Deposits

A large unexplained deposit shortly before lodging can raise financial credibility concerns.

Previous Refusals Not Disclosed

Immigration history should be declared accurately. Hiding a previous refusal can undermine your credibility.

Vague Purpose of Visit

A generic travel statement doesn’t provide enough context. Give specific, consistent information about your trip.

No Further Stay Condition

Applicants in Australia must carefully check their current visa conditions before trying to lodge another onshore application.

Inconsistent Documents

Different spellings, dates, salaries, addresses, or employment information across documents can raise unnecessary questions.

Weak Health Insurance Evidence

For longer visits and applicants from countries without reciprocal healthcare arrangements, appropriate private health insurance is an important part of responsible travel planning.

Subclass 600 vs ETA vs eVisitor

Not every traveler needs a Subclass 600. Australia also has the ETA and eVisitor systems for eligible passport holders.

FeatureSubclass 600ETA 601eVisitor 651
AvailabilityBroad range of nationalitiesSelected passportsMainly eligible European passports
Typical processingDays to weeksOften rapidGenerally rapid
WorkNoNoNo
TourismYesYesYes
Pakistani passportYesNoNo
Indian passportYesNoNo
Possible stayUp to 3, 6, or 12 months depending on grantUp to 3 months per visitUp to 3 months per visit

The supplied source identifies Subclass 600 as the relevant tourist visa option for Pakistani and Indian passport holders who aren’t eligible for the ETA or eVisitor.

Tourist Visa Australia from Pakistan: Important Advice

For Pakistani applicants, preparing a well-supported application is particularly important.

The strongest applications usually present a clear connection between the applicant’s personal circumstances, finances, travel plans, and reason for returning to Pakistan.

Show Strong Ties to Pakistan

Useful evidence may include:

  • Stable employment
  • Employer NOC
  • Approved leave
  • Property
  • Business ownership
  • Spouse and children
  • Other significant family responsibilities

Provide Consistent Banking History

Six months of bank statements can help demonstrate normal financial activity. Avoid unexplained deposits that appear immediately before your application.

The source specifically recommends genuine and consistent banking evidence rather than temporary funds introduced only to strengthen the balance.

Include Previous Travel History

Previous lawful international travel can help demonstrate that you have complied with immigration requirements elsewhere. Where relevant, include previous visas, entry stamps, and grant notices.

Explain Your Trip Clearly

Your statement should answer practical questions:

  • Why are you visiting Australia?
  • Who are you visiting?
  • What is your relationship with them?
  • Where will you stay?
  • How long will you remain?
  • What will you do?
  • Why will you return to Pakistan?

A clear answer is better than a long, generic story.
